A solar powered outdoor outlet is a device that allows you to charge your outdoor equipment using solar power. Through its integrated solar panel, it converts solar energy into usable electricity. This way, charging mobile devices, power lighting, and even operating small appliances without an external power source is possible.
Solar generators with outdoor outlets are more efficient than solar powered outdoor outlets. The reason for that is that a solar generator with outdoor outlets provides sufficient power to charge both small and large appliances for extended periods. A 100W solar panel can power up multiple small devices, such as table lamps, cell phone fans, Wi-Fi routers, laptops, and other small electronic devices. Heaters, air conditioning systems, TVs, and other big appliances require more than one 100W solar panel.

Solar panels convert sunlight into electricity while charge controllers regulate power flow to protect batteries. Deep-cycle batteries store energy for use when needed and inverters transform DC battery power into AC household current. Additional components include mounting hardware safety disconnects surge protectors and monitoring systems.
